fix: prevent panic in standby mixcoord during shutdown (#45730)
issue: #45728
When mixcoord is in standby mode and shutdown is triggered, the
ProcessActiveStandBy goroutine may panic if context cancellation occurs.
This happens because the error handling didn't check for
context.Canceled errors before panicking.

Changes:
- Add context cancellation check in mix_coord Register() before panic
- Check s.ctx.Err() == context.Canceled and gracefully exit
- Remove unused ForceActiveStandby() function from session_util

This ensures standby mixcoord can shutdown gracefully without panic when
context is cancelled during the standby process.
